Tom Daley is reportedly being pursued by producers of two of the UK's biggest TV shows.

Producers of Strictly Come Dancing and I'm A Celebrity... Get Me Out Of Here! are reportedly engaged in a battle to sign up Tom Daley this year.

The Olympics-winning Team GB diver will turn 28 next month and has made no secret of his desire to take on more TV projects as his competitive sporting career comes to a close.

According to the Daily Mail, two of the UK's biggest TV shows are hoping to convince him to join their lineup later this year.

"There is a race to secure Tom – both broadcasters know he will be loved by viewers," a source told the newspaper.

"Strictly bosses feel sure that he will stay in the competition until very near to the end, if not the final – while ITV feels he would be perfect fit to join other celebrities in the jungle.

"Tom has a broad fanbase but is very popular with the 16 to 24 age bracket, which both the BBC and ITV are keen to keep watching their shows."

Daley's diving partner Matty Lee appeared on I'm A Celebrity last year, while his Team GB teammate Adam Peaty competed on Strictly.
